Background technology
Traditional tubing is derived by two-layer fabric, and most common product is rotary hose.Modern times exploitation So-called tubing, has not been traditional tubing, but in some areas of fabric, be made into similar to tubulose Fabric.Tubing has warp-wise tubing and broadwise tubing, the mechanism that warp-wise tubing is formed and broadwise tubulose The formation mechenism of fabric is differed completely.Warp-wise tubing weft yarn needs to use stretch yarn, reverse side of the stretch yarn in fabric The floating length of latitude is formed, under fabric after machine, the support of temple is lost, using the elastic force of weft yarn, latitude is floated the reverse side in fabric long and is shunk, The front of fabric is raised, and the fabric similar to tubulose effect is formed in fabric face.Broadwise tubing has body warp and plays pipe Warp thread, when not playing pipe, body warp interweaves as pipe warp thread is played, and is not different, and when at the system of knitting to pipe, warp thread is divided into two System, body warp and plays a pipe warp thread, body warp not with weft yarns, formed through floating length in fabric backing, play pipe warp thread and weft yarn Interweave, form plain cloth.At the end of the tube portion system of knitting is played, instruction is sent by dobby, by batching for GA747 looms The fastener that batches of mechanism lifts, and spooler filling density wheel loses support falling backward and turns, and is moved after fell, when beating up again, due to ground warp Yarn is that, through floating line long, weft yarn is compressed through floating generation sliding on line long through floating length;The another side of fabric be by pipe warp thread and Weft yarns into, weft yarn will not produce sliding rising on pipe warp thread, it is raised to play fabric at pipe, forms broadwise pipe.Tubulose is knitted Thing can play pipe with one side, it is also possible to two-sided pipe, mainly be determined according to the position for floating line long.Broadwise tubulose is formed through floating line long Fabric, latitude floats line long and forms warp-wise tubing.Line long is floated in the front of fabric, pipe floats line long and exist just in the reverse side of fabric The reverse side of fabric, pipe is just in the front of fabric.

Specific embodiment
With reference to specific embodiment, the present invention will be described in detail.
A kind of production technology of broadwise tubing, comprises the following steps:Fabric Design → winder → warping → sizing → Gait → weave → Final finishing.
(1) Fabric Design:
Fabric Design of the invention is as follows:
Broadwise tubing, warp thread is divided into body warp and plays pipe warp thread, it is necessary to when forming broadwise tubing, only play pipe Warp thread and weft yarns, body warp not with weft yarns, form the floating length of warp-wise in the reverse side of fabric, warp-wise floats a length of 4 latitude * 6+1 =25 latitudes, when rise a tubing knit system at the end of, body warp and rise pipe warp thread together with weft yarns, formation two pipes between Plain weave.
It is starting and the end position for distinguishing broadwise tubing during design, terminates place in cop beginning and cop, respectively 2 weft yarns of blueness are woven, the origin and destination of broadwise tubing are represented, to prevent that position deviation occurs during line paper punching, influence The quality of fabric.This 4 blue weft yarns, can also form barre in fabric backing simultaneously, increased the aesthetic feeling of fabric.
The basic organization of broadwise tubing is preferably plain weave, and often, cloth cover is fine and smooth, fabric for plain weave Perception is good, if doing basic organization with its hetero-organization, cloth cover can seem coarse.
Warp thread is 40S bleached yarns, only a kind of color;Weft yarn is C32S, and weft yarn has red, blue, white, light green etc. four Color, 35 red yarns and 35 light green yarns are planted, knit system is plain weave;25 white yarns, form broadwise pipe, in pipe The starting point and end point of son, it is each to weave 2 blue yarns.Barry dyeing is arranged:35 is red, and 2 is blue, and 25 is white, and 2 is blue, and 35 is light green, and 2 is blue, and 25 In vain, 2 is blue.
The total quantity of warps of fabric is 4744, the 9*2 roots when yarn is every.Body warp and pipe warp thread are 2363, by 1:1 row Row.
The specification of fabric is as follows:Fabric breadth be 155.3cm, fabric through it is close be 305/10cm, upper machine reed width is 168cm, porter is 141 teeth/10cm, and the filling density at fabric ground tissue is 264/10cm, the filling density gear base area group of loom Knit the filling density design at place, it is not necessary to the average filling density for considering fabric and the fill yarn ends for forming pipe.
(2) winder
From GA014 (MD) type grooved drum type spooler, the type bobbin-winding machine is by the limited public affairs of textile machine of Suzhou City Wuzhong the 3rd Department's production, winder speed has four kinds, respectively 510m/min, 575m/min, 643m/min, 713m/min.Tension adjustment packing ring Have it is light, in, weigh three kinds.This fabric warp is 40S single thread, and winder speed is set as 575m/min, and weft yarn is 32S single thread, winder Speed is set as 643m/min, tension washer of the tension washer from medium wt.To ensure the quality of fabric, hand-held is used Air splicer joint.
(3) warping
From GA121 (A) beam warper.400~740m/min of vehicle speed range, the capacity of bobbin cradle is 720, is originally knitted Thing warp thread is 40S, and the speed of beaming of selection is 500m/min, collective's creeling.Tensioner is twin columns disc type, is wrapped by changing Angle regulation tension force is enclosed, tension adjustment is divided into 11 gears, during this fabric warping, bobbin cradle is divided into 4 sections, and most leading portion tension force is 6 grades, by preceding Backward, one grade of setting drops in additional tension successively.
Fabric total quantity of warps is 4744, and body warp and a pipe warp thread are 2363, and 18, side yarn, side warp thread and ground are passed through Yarn warping together.Through being made into 4 axles, warping is with axle on ground:595*3+596*1;Through warping into 4 axles, warping is flower with axle:590*1+ 591*3。
(4) sizing
From the unit warp sizing machine of ASG365 types two.Slashing technique is:PVA 1,799 50%, TB225 converted starches 50%, Slurries solid content 7%~7.5%, viscosity 11s~13s, the rate of sizing 8%, the pressure 16KN of preceding squeezing roller, the pressure of post jacking roller It is 12KN, slurry groove temperature is controlled at 85 DEG C~90 DEG C.
This textile be cotton, formula of size should based on converted starch, but knitting system of broadwise tubing, formation During cop, body warp needs to bear larger tension force and frictional force, therefore requirement to sizing is higher, and yarn should strengthen, and Increase mill, therefore PVA slurries are added in formula of size, formula of size is the converted starch of 50%PVA and 50%.It is such The serous coat for being formulated formation is soft, wear-resisting, and yarn body is bright and clean, and filoplume fits perfectly.The pressure of squeezing roller uses preceding heavy rear light technique, The pressure of preceding squeezing roller is larger, and yarn interior is squeezed into beneficial to by slurries.Preferably it is impregnated with obtaining, increases the strength of yarn; The pressure of post jacking roller is smaller, preferably coated to obtain, and increases the wearability of yarn yarn.Slurry is mixed slurry, and PVA is used Amount is larger, therefore the rate of sizing need not be too high.The rate of sizing is controlled 8%.
(5) gait
This fabric total quantity of warps is 4774, and comprehensive using page 4, using space draft, ground heddle is through proparea, uses 1-2 Page is comprehensive;Play pipe warp thread and be through back zone, it is comprehensive using 3-4 pages;While comprehensive through being through 1-2 pages.Enter per reed 2 when plugging in reed, a body warp, one Root plays pipe warp thread.Menopause tablet uses 4 rows.
(6) weave
The present invention carries out the system of knitting from GA747 types rapier loom, and loom speed is 204r/min.Opening time is 295 °, Enter the sword time for 75 °, weft yarn release time is identical with opening time, weft yarn release length is upper machine reed width+12CM, waste selvage yarn root Number is 16, and back beam height is 70mm.
Twin shaft is weaved:Warp thread has two systems, body warp and a pipe warp thread, and when not playing pipe, body warp and a pipe warp thread do not have Have any different, normally interweave with weft yarn together, form ground tissue;When at the system of knitting a to pipe, body warp does not interweave with weft yarn, only The warp thread and weft yarns of pipe are played, causes body warp and a pipe warp thread crimp different.When forming broadwise pipe, pipe warp thread is played also The anxious warp let-off is needed, therefore it is very big, it is necessary to be weaved with twin shaft with the crimp difference of body warp to play pipe warp thread.Body warp tension force compared with Greatly, the original let-off mechanism of loom is used;Play pipe warp tension smaller, the warp let-off is controlled using frictional force.The beam of a loom of pipe warp thread is played, Mounted in the top of the back rest, with the distance controlling of the back rest in 6-8cm or so.
The formation of broadwise pipe:The formation of broadwise pipe is controlled using the method for stopping volume.Fabric tissue is comprehensive using 1-4 pages, Use the formation of comprehensive control broadwise pipe of page 5.The formation of broadwise pipe is controlled by dobby, when the fabric system of knitting to When root broadwise pipe terminates place, that is, this fabric system of knitting to second group 2 blue yarns, by dobby, steel wire rope, lead To wheel etc. by the fastener pull-up of spooler, after spooler loses fastener support, in the presence of face tension, worm and gear Spooler is reversed, and is moved after fell, because body warp does not interweave with weft yarn, in fabric backing, formation be all through floating line long, When reed breaks to fell blue weft yarn, due to being moved after fell, weft yarn is through floating generation sliding, the warp of fabric backing on line long Line long is floated to be compressed;Play pipe warp and weft yarns, the fabric of formation, in the front of fabric, because reverse side is through the quilt of floating line long Compression, fabric face is raised, forms pipe.In order to prevent broadwise pipe due to the pulling force of warp tension, raised pipe diminishes, After ensureing continuous urgent two blue weft yarns, then put down and batch fastener, just can guarantee that the quality of broadwise tubing.
Broadwise tube length is controlled:Using the broadwise pipe that volume method is controlled is stopped, because fell back amount is limited, system is knitted By a definite limitation, the warp for forming cop floats the length of line long and to control within 6mm the size of broadwise pipe, through floating length Fabric of the line more than more than 6mm, using stopping the volume method system of knitting, it is very difficult to ensure the quality of fabric.The back amount of fell and fabric The frictional force of brake band in gap, spooler between warp tension, worm and gear etc. is relevant, but the broadwise tubing system of knitting Shi Buneng is by changing the gap between warp tension, worm and gear, the frictional force of the brake band of spooler adjusts fell Back amount because the back amount of fell is big, be easy to produce the faults such as uneven weaving during weaving.
Warp tension:Play the warp tension of pipe warp thread, by frictional force control, due to rising during pipe, should the anxious warp let-off, prevent again When only forming pipe, due to playing the tension force of pipe warp thread, pipe is caused to diminish, the quality of cloth, perception are deteriorated, therefore play pipe warp thread Tension force will try one's best control less than normal;The single thread mean tension of body warp wants control bigger than normal, and reason is:When forming broadwise pipe, weft yarn Sliding is produced on warp thread, when being compressed through floating line long, body warp must be tightened, the good pipe of shaping, ground warp could be formed Tension force is small, easily forms shyer in fabric backing.When this fabric knits processed, because body warp only has more than 2300, and warp thread is thinner, Therefore on the tension weight hammer stem of both sides, a tension weight of 2.5kg is respectively configured.
The selvedge of fabric:The selvedge of broadwise tubing is difficult smooth.By taking this fabric as an example, finished product filling density is at ground tissue 292/10cm, and at pipe, the width of fabric only has 2mm, fill yarn ends reach 29, and the filling density of fabric increases to 1450 Root/10cm, if every weft yarn all interweaves with selvedge, selvedge can not be smooth, therefore during the production of this natural selvedge, from three Aspect is set about, and one is the radical for reducing selvedge yarn, per side selvedge only with 9 Gen Bianbian yarns;Two is the interleaving degress for reducing selvedge yarn, Selvedge, as selvedge, so reduces the interleaving degress of selvedge yarn as far as possible using plain weave+latitude galassing;Three is that the system of knitting is arrived at broadwise pipe When, the weft yarn only met half way participates in the intertexture with selvedge yarn, and this half weft yarn is when forming selvedge, as a weft yarn, with Selvedge yarn interweaves;Second half weft yarn is not involved in the intertexture of selvedge yarn, but needs to allow waste selvage yarn to clamp, and prevents these weft yarn yarn tails from invading Enter selvedge, influence the quality of fabric.
Warp thread is divided into body warp and plays pipe warp thread by the present invention, is risen at pipe in broadwise and there was only pipe warp thread and weft yarns, Body warp forms the floating length of warp-wise in the reverse side of fabric;In winder, warping, sizing and the operation such as gait, preferably each technological parameter; Weaved using the twin shaft of GA747 rapier looms, broadwise pipe is formed by the evolution of spooler fastener;For broadwise pipe The selvedge out-of-flatness problem of shape fabric, participated at cop what is interweaved from reducing Side End Number, reducing side yarn interleaving degress and reduces Three aspects of weft yarn number are set about, and make cop natural selvedge smooth.
